Federal Teen Pregnancy Prevention Funding Guidelines Announced

The federal Office of Adolescent Health has released guidelines for two different funding opportunities. Tier One funds are for of replication of evidence-based teen pregnancy prevention programs. Tier Two funds are for research and demonstration grants to develop, replicate, refine and test additional models and innovative strategies for preventing teen pregnancy. Both announcements are available on the federal Office of Adolescent Health website.

Four funding ranges have been identified:

  • Range A: $400,000 to $600,000 per year
  • Range B: $600,000 to $1,000,000 per year
  • Range C: $1,000,000 to $1,500,000 per year
  • Range D: $1,500,000 to $4,000,000 per year

Application deadlines:

  • Letter of Intent: May 3, 2010
  • Application: June 1, 2010

MOAPPP’s Response

After careful review of both announcements, MOAPPP has decided to submit an application for Tier One funds to support Minnesota organizations in replicating one of three evidence-based programs we currently train on:

  • Cuídate!
  • Making Proud Choices
  • Teen Outreach Program (TOP)

See MOAPPP’s Adolescent Pregnancy Prevention webpage for more information on each program.

MOAPPP released a Request for Proposals to identify organizations that are interested in faithfully replicating one of these programs. We are currently reviewing applications and MOAPPP will notify the selected agencies no later than Friday, May 21, 2010.
